Telephone and Data Systems, Inc., a FORTUNE 500 company, is a diversified telecommunications corporation founded in 1969. Through its strategic business units, U.S. Cellular and TDS Telecom, TDS operates primarily by providing wireless and wireline service. TDS builds value for its shareholders by providing excellent communications services in growing, closely related segments of the telecommunications industry. As of March 31, 2004, the company employed approximately 10,700 people and served approximately 5.6 million customers/units in 36 states. For more information, visit http://www.teldta.com .

U.S. Cellular, the nation's eighth largest wireless service carrier, provides wireless service to more than 4.5 million customers in 26 states. The Chicago-based company operates on a customer satisfaction strategy, meeting customer needs by providing a comprehensive range of wireless products and services, superior customer support and a high-quality network.
